Radiology CT Technologist Team. Responsibilities
Under general supervision of the Radiologist, perform CT procedures to acquire digital images for physician diagnosis and treatment. Plan and perform CT procedures and post-processing using advanced technology based on clinical criteria, anatomy, and established protocols. Ensure the CT protocol selection adheres to guidelines and that dose data is compiled with alerts if scans exceed preset levels. Operate CT scanners, power injectors and computer systems to acquire images for radiologists. Maintain knowledge to operate different CT systems at multiple locations. Maintain protocols aligned with Image Gently Guidelines and dose-tracking programs. Maintain knowledge of clinical histories to select appropriate protocols; demonstrate knowledge of thoracic, abdominal, pelvic, neuro, and musculoskeletal systems. Obtain CT images according to established protocols; ensure patient preparation, positioning, immobilization, shielding where applicable, and correct technical factors. Perform CT interventional procedures and CTA imaging (carotid, head, vertebral, run-offs, critical bolus timing) including advanced studies such as TAVR, EVAR, and cardiac imaging. Maintain pharmacology knowledge to ensure any required labs are obtained prior to scheduled exams; apply physiology and physics knowledge to optimize scans and minimize patient dose. Interpret technical factors to improve image quality or speed as needed. Work is typically performed in a clinical environment. All job-specific obligations and organization policies apply.
